Economy & Jobs

The median household income in Lakeport is $63,929, 15% below the national average of $75,149. The job market is very strong with unemployment at just 0.9%. The poverty rate of 17.7% exceeds the national average of 12.4%, indicating economic hardship for a significant portion of the population. Workers commute an average of 22 minutes.

Cost of Living & Housing

The median home value in Lakeport is $119,900, 57% below the national median / offering relatively affordable homeownership. Renters pay a median of $1,161 per month. At just 1.9x median income, home prices are very affordable relative to local earnings.

Safety & Crime

Violent crime in Lakeport is below the national average at 333 per 100,000 residents (U.S. avg: 380). Property crime occurs at a rate of 3,603 per 100,000, 84% above the national average.

Education

14.3% of residents hold a bachelor's degree, below the national average of 33.7%. 82.7% have completed high school. Area schools have an average test score of 5.2/10.

Climate & Weather

Lakeport enjoys a moderate climate with an average annual temperature of 66°F. Winters average 48°F in January while summers reach 84°F in July. With 308 sunny days per year, residents enjoy well above the national average of sunshine. Annual precipitation totals 45.3 inches. Air quality is rated Good with a median AQI of 42.

Lakeport has a population of 1,250 with a density of 786 people per square mile, spread across 1.6 square miles. The median age is 31.6 years, 19% younger than the national median of 38.9. The gender split is 51.7% female and 48.3% male. The city is predominantly Black (47.8%), with 25% White, 2.3% Hispanic. English is the primary language spoken at home by 81% of residents, while 19% speak Spanish. 5.5% of the population are veterans. 10.6% of residents have a disability. 83.6% have health insurance coverage.

The median household income in Lakeport is $63,929, which is 15% below the national average of $75,149. Per capita income is $24,245 (below the $39,052 national figure). The average weekly wage is $1,127, 21% lower than the U.S. average. The unemployment rate is 0.9% (below the 3.6% US average). 17.7% of residents live below the poverty line, higher than the national rate of 12.4%. The area has 4,316 business establishments, including 380 restaurants. The cost of living index is 97.1, roughly in line with the national average. Workers commute an average of 22 minutes (shorter than the 28-minute US average). 4.0% of workers work from home (below the 15.2% national rate).

The median home value in Lakeport is $119,900, 57% below the national median of $281,900. Zillow estimates the typical home value at $225,365, higher than the Census estimate. Monthly rent averages $1,161 (0% below the national average of $1,163). Fair market rent ranges from $935 for a one-bedroom to $1,149 for a two-bedroom apartment. 73.3% of housing units are owner-occupied (above the 65.4% national rate). There are 441 total housing units in the city. The median year a home was built is 1988. The average annual property tax is $6,591 (higher than the $3,500 national average). 33.4% of renters spend 30% or more of their income on housing. The home price-to-income ratio is 1.9x, well within the affordable range.

In Lakeport, 40.4% of adults are obese, above the national rate of 32.1%. 14.1% have diabetes (above the 10.5% national rate). Heart disease affects 5.6% of residents. 39.1% have high blood pressure. 14.5% are current smokers. 15.2% report binge drinking. 30.1% are physically inactive, above the national average. 20.7% report depression. 18.6% experience frequent mental distress. 16.4% of residents lack health insurance (above the 8.6% national rate). The primary care physician ratio is 1:1,099. The dentist ratio is 1:996. 86.0% of residents have access to exercise opportunities. The food environment index is 6.8 out of 10.

Lakeport enjoys a temperate climate with an average annual temperature of 66°F (19°C). Winters average 48°F in January while summers reach 84°F in July. The area gets 308 sunny days per year, well above the U.S. average of 205 / making it one of the sunnier locations in the country. Annual precipitation totals 45.3 inches. Air quality is rated Good with a median AQI of 42. The city sits at an elevation of 307 feet.
